c语言if语句星座匹配度
时间: 2024-10-18 08:12:22 浏览: 13
C语言中的`if`语句主要用于基于特定条件执行代码块。如果想要编写一个简单的星座匹配度判断程序,你可以创建一个`if`结构来检查用户输入的出生月份和日子,然后根据常见的星座划分(如白羊座、金牛座等)来确定匹配程度。例如:
```c
#include <stdio.h>
int main() {
int month, day;
printf("请输入您的出生月份 (1-12) 和日子 (1-31): ");
scanf("%d %d", &month, &day);
if (month >= 1 && month <= 3) { // 白羊座 (3月21日 - 4月19日)
if (day >= 21 && day <= 31) {
printf("您是白羊座,星座匹配度较高!\n");
} else {
printf("您接近白羊座,可能有些相似特征。\n");
}
// ...继续添加其他星座的判断
return 0;
}
阅读全文